Aims and Scopes

The 'Revista de Investigaciones-Universidad del Quindio' aims to disseminate innovative research across a broad range of disciplines, promoting interdisciplinary collaboration and addressing contemporary societal challenges. The journal encompasses empirical studies, theoretical analyses, and methodological advancements that contribute to knowledge and practice in various fields.
  1. Environmental and Agricultural Sciences:
    Research focusing on the sustainability of natural resources, agricultural practices, and environmental health, including studies on seed storage, pest management, and climate impact.
  2. Health and Medical Research:
    Investigations related to public health, medical practices, and health education, including topics like antimicrobial resistance, the effects of COVID-19, and child obesity.
  3. Social Sciences and Humanities:
    Exploration of social movements, gender studies, and educational methodologies, emphasizing cultural contexts and societal issues, particularly in Latin America.
  4. Technological Innovations and Education:
    Studies on the impact of technology in educational settings, including the use of digital tools for teaching and learning, as well as the implications of the 4th Industrial Revolution.
  5. Organizational and Economic Studies:
    Research on management practices, organizational culture, and economic policies, focusing on the intersection of business and societal outcomes.
The journal has seen a notable increase in research themes that reflect contemporary societal challenges and technological advancements. These emerging scopes are relevant for researchers seeking to address current issues and innovate practices.
  1. Impact of COVID-19:
    There is a significant focus on the effects of the COVID-19 pandemic across various sectors, including health, education, and social behavior, highlighting the pandemic's transformative impact on societies.
  2. Digital Transformation in Education:
    Emerging studies examine the integration of digital tools and methodologies in education, reflecting the shift towards online learning and the need for innovative educational practices.
  3. Social Justice and Inequality:
    Research addressing social justice issues, including gender equality and the impacts of social movements, has gained traction, aligning with global conversations on equity and rights.
  4. Health and Wellbeing:
    Increasing attention is given to health-related research, particularly mental health and public health interventions, as societies grapple with the long-term effects of the pandemic.
  5. Sustainability and Environmental Research:
    A growing number of studies focus on sustainable practices and environmental health, indicating an increasing awareness of ecological issues and the need for sustainable development.

Declining or Waning

While the journal has maintained a diverse range of topics, certain themes appear to be losing prominence in recent publications. This decline may reflect shifting research priorities or changes in societal focus.
  1. Traditional Agricultural Practices:
    Research related to conventional agricultural methods is less frequent, as there is a growing emphasis on sustainable and innovative practices in the face of climate change.
  2. Historical and Cultural Studies:
    Though still present, studies focusing solely on historical narratives or cultural artifacts have decreased, possibly due to a shift towards more applied social sciences and current issues.
  3. Legal Studies:
    Legal research, particularly concerning local practices and regulations, is less prominent, indicating a possible shift towards more pressing social and economic topics.
